Rapid Prototyping with JavaScript
The Rapid Prototyping training is geared towards helping software engineers and others with basic Javascript skills to rapidly build software prototypes with Node.js and MongoDB. You'll walk out with one or a few web applications and the skills to continue developing your own.
Node.js is a platform built on Chrome's JavaScript runtime for easily building fast, scalable network applications. Node.js uses an event-driven, non-blocking I/O model that makes it lightweight and efficient, perfect for data-intensive real-time applications that run across distributed devices.
MongoDB (from "humongous") is a scalable, high-performance, open source NoSQL database, written in C++. MongoDB simplifies application development and is considered one of the most disruptive software technologies.

Objectives:
You will become familiarized with NodeJS, jQuery, MongoDB and fast prototyping. You will be able to build simple prototypes very quickly and deploy them to Windows Azure.
Topics:
Importance of moving fast, Agile, continuous deployment
TDDIntroduction to JavaScript, history (LiveScript) and evolution.
Stack overview: NodeJS + MongoDB + HTML + CSS + JSNodeJS and its advantages.
MongoDB and noSQL concept for cloud computing.
Structure of HTTP Request and Response: headers, bodyRESTful API vs SOAP.
Overview of HTML, CSS, JS (client)AJAX, Cross-domain calls, JSONPjQuery, Twitter Bootstrap
Prerequisites:
Attendees are strongly encouraged to have basic programming knowledge, JavaScript skills and familiarity with web development.
